are you looking for a simultaneous 5 axis machine or simultaneous 3 + auxiliary 2. Die & Mould are mostly done on 3 axis + auxiliary, but again that depends on the part to be manufactured, whether it requires simultaneous 5 axis or not.
For your mold target mentioned, you can go ahead with simultaneous 3 axis + auxiliary. I guess if you are looking for Mazak, VCS series or VCN can be used in simultaneous 3 axis + rotary + apc/atc etc..
